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Flemington
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
The "Spring Replacement" Bait-and-Switch
A technician quotes you a low price to fix a torsion spring, then after they start the job, they claim the springs are "special order" or that the cables, drums, and brackets also need replacing — tripling your final bill.
The Magnetic Sensor Scare
A technician points to your safety sensors and claims they are "faulty" or "out of alignment" and must be replaced immediately for $200-$400. In reality, sensors are often just dirty or slightly bumped out of place and only need a simple adjustment or cleaning.
The Phantom Emergency Callout
A company advertises 24/7 emergency service in Flemington with low flat rates, but when they arrive, they tack on "after-hours fees," "weekend surcharges," and "emergency response fees" that were never mentioned on the phone or website.
The Unnecessary Opener Replacement
The technician claims your garage door opener is "burned out" or "too old to repair" and insists you need a brand-new smart opener costing $500-$800. Often the issue is just a simple fix like a snapped belt, bad capacitor, or tripped circuit breaker.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Always ask for a certificate of general liability insurance and workers' compensation coverage. Call the insurance provider listed on the certificate to confirm the policy is active. If a technician gets hurt on your property without workers' comp, you could be held liable for medical bills.
Licensing
New Jersey does not require a state-level license specifically for garage door repair, but check that the business is registered with the New Jersey Division of Revenue. Ask for their business registration number and verify it through the NJ Department of Treasury's online database. Also confirm any necessary local permits through Hunterdon County or Flemington Borough.
References
Ask for at least three recent local references from Flemington or nearby Hunterdon County clients. Call them and ask about the quality of work, whether the job stayed on budget, and if any follow-up issues arose. Check Google Reviews, Yelp, and the Better Business Bureau for patterns of complaints.
